Skip to main content

Link Budget Calculations

Given all the assumptions, models and calculations we have seen in the above sections, in this section we describe the link budget calculations as implemented in the tool. This section has two parts:

  1. Received Signal Level (RSL) calculation procedure
  2. Signal-to-interference-plus-noise (SINR) ration using the interference models

RSL Calculation

Assuming you are transmitting from Site A to Site B, below is a simple link budget to calculate the RSL in dBm

RSL=PAMA+GAPL+GBMBRSL = PA-MA+GA-PL+GB-MB

where,

  • PAPA = Transmit Power at A
  • MAMA = Miscellaneous Losses at A
  • GAGA = Antenna Gain measured at the deviation from the boresight at A
  • PLPL = FSPL + GAL
  • GBGB = Antenna Gain measured at the deviation from the boresight at B
  • MBMB = Miscellaneous Losses at B

SINR Calculation

For every receiver site Rxn there is an intended transmitter site T xn. Any other transmitter that has LOS to this receiver is considered as source of interference. Say T xi is once such transmitter where i ̸= n. The interference power from the ith transmitter on nth receiver is calculated as

Ii,n=PAiMAi+GAiPL+GBnMBnI_{i,n} = PA_{i} - MA_{i} + GA_{i} - PL + GB_{n} - MB_{n}

where,

  • PAiPA_{i} = Transmit Power from TxiTx_{i}
  • MAiMA_{i} = Miscellaneous Losses at TxiTx_{i}
  • GAiGA_{i} = Antenna Gain measured at the deviation from the boresight at A
  • PLPL = Pathloss (FSPL+GAFSPL + GA) from ii to nn
  • GBnGB_{n} = Antenna Gain measured at the deviation from the boresight at RxnRx_{n}
  • MBnMB_{n} = Miscellaneous Losses at RxnRx_{n}

The SINRnSINR_{n} (in dBm) at RxnRx_{n} is calculated using the following formula:

SINRn=10log10RSLnIi,no+NpNFSINR_{n} = 10\log_{10}{\frac{RSL_{n}}{\sum{I^{o}_{i,n} + N_{p}}}} - NF

where,

  • RSLnRSL_{n} = the RSLRSL calculated from the intended transmitter TxnTx_{n} in mW
  • NpN_{p} = the thermal noise power calculated using the following equation in mW
  • Ii,noI^{o}_{i,n} = the interference power in mW
  • NFNF = Noise Figure in dB
Np=KTBN_{p} = KTB

where,

  • KK = Boltzmann’s constant
  • TT = the system temperature in K
  • BB = the used bandwidth in Hz

Note that in the absence of any interference, the SINR simply boils down to SNR. In that case, the SNR (in dB) can be directly calculated using the equation below:

SNRn=RSLnNpNFSNR_{n} = RSL_{n} - N_{p} - NF

where the unit of each variable is

  • SNRnSNR_{n}: dB
  • RSLnRSL_{n}: dBm
  • NpN_{p}: dBm
  • NFNF: dB

MCS Table Lookup

As a final step, the SINR calculated in the above section is then used to find the best operating MCS given the link availability conditions and hardware specific backoff recom- mendations. The following table is used for 3-9s of link availability. Note that this table is consistent with the 802.11ad chipsets with typical backoff values.

MCSSNR(dB)Datarate(Mbps)Backoff(dB)
3300
44.567.50
551150
65.52600
77.5452.50
896450
912741.250
101410302
111614154
121818006